当 Angular 2 组件完全加载时

lbr*_*him 5 javascript angular

我似乎找不到一个钩子,通过它我可以知道由其他子组件组成的组件已完全完成加载,包括数据绑定和所有内容。例如,采用以下模板ParentComponent

<div>
    <child-one>
        {{textOne}}
    </child-one>
    <child-two>
        {{textTwo}}
    </child-two>
</div>
Run Code Online (Sandbox Code Playgroud)

任何建议都受到高度赞赏。

Gün*_*uer 4

ngAfterViewInit() {}被调用时或者如果内容被传递 ( <ng-content>),则在ngAfterContentInit()被调用之后。


  • ngAfterViewInit()视图初始化完成后调用。在此状态下组件已完全加载并初始化。
  • 如果传递给组件的子项也应该完全加载,则使用ngAfterContentInit()它。